数据库中filename是什么

fiy 其他 23

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,filename是一个字段或列的名称,用于存储文件的名称或路径。它通常用于存储文件在系统中的位置或名称,以便于将文件与其他数据关联起来。以下是关于filename字段的一些常见用途和注意事项:

    1. 存储文件名称:filename字段用于存储文件的名称,这样可以在数据库中轻松地查找和识别特定文件。例如,如果数据库中存储了许多图片文件,可以使用filename字段来存储每个图片的名称,以便在需要时能够轻松地检索和显示它们。

    2. 存储文件路径:除了存储文件名称,filename字段也可以用于存储文件的完整路径。这对于需要在系统中定位和访问文件的应用程序非常有用。例如,如果数据库需要存储一些文档文件,可以使用filename字段来存储每个文件的完整路径,以便在需要时可以直接打开或下载文件。

    3. 关联其他数据:filename字段可以用于将文件与其他数据关联起来。例如,在一个电子商务网站的数据库中,可以使用filename字段将产品图片与相应的产品记录关联起来。这样,当用户浏览产品时,可以通过filename字段找到并显示与该产品相关的图片。

    4. 文件类型验证:filename字段还可以用于验证文件类型。通过检查文件名的扩展名或使用其他验证方法,可以确保只接受特定类型的文件。这有助于提高系统的安全性和完整性,防止恶意文件或非法文件的上传。

    5. 文件管理和维护:filename字段还可以用于文件管理和维护。通过使用特定的文件命名规则或在filename字段中添加其他元数据,可以轻松地对文件进行分类、排序和搜索。此外,可以根据filename字段的值来执行文件的备份、删除或移动操作。

    总之,filename字段在数据库中的作用是存储文件的名称或路径,并与其他数据关联起来,以方便文件的检索、管理和使用。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,filename是一个用于存储文件名的字段。它通常被用于存储文件在数据库中的路径或者文件的实际名称。filename字段的作用是为了方便在数据库中管理和检索文件。

    在数据库中存储文件通常有两种方法:一种是将文件直接存储在数据库中,另一种是将文件存储在文件系统中,然后在数据库中保存文件的路径或者名称。

    如果采用第一种方法,filename字段会存储文件的实际名称。例如,当我们上传一个名为"example.jpg"的图片时,filename字段会存储"example.jpg"。

    如果采用第二种方法,filename字段会存储文件在文件系统中的路径。例如,当我们上传一个名为"example.jpg"的图片时,filename字段可能会存储"/uploads/example.jpg"。

    无论是存储路径还是文件名,filename字段在数据库中都起到了标识文件的作用。通过查询filename字段,我们可以找到对应的文件,并进行相关的操作,例如下载、删除等。

    需要注意的是,filename字段的具体命名可以根据实际需求进行调整。有些数据库表中可能会使用其他的字段名,例如file_path、file_name等,但它们的作用和功能与filename字段相同。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,filename是一个用来存储文件名的字段。它通常用于存储文件的名称,例如图片、文档、音频或视频文件的名称。

    在数据库中存储文件名的字段是非常常见的,因为它可以帮助我们更好地管理和组织文件。使用filename字段,我们可以轻松地在数据库中查找和访问特定的文件,或者将文件与其他相关数据关联起来。

    为了使用filename字段,我们需要创建一个合适的数据表,并在该表中添加一个名为filename的列。在创建表时,我们需要指定filename列的数据类型,通常使用字符串类型(varchar)来存储文件名。

    以下是一些常见的数据库操作和流程,用于展示如何使用filename字段:

    1. 创建数据库表
      首先,我们需要创建一个适当的数据库表来存储文件信息。在创建表时,我们需要包含一个filename列来存储文件名。例如,我们可以使用以下SQL语句创建一个名为files的表:
    CREATE TABLE files (
      id INT PRIMARY KEY AUTO_INCREMENT,
      filename VARCHAR(255)
    );
    

    上述语句将创建一个包含id和filename列的表。id列用于唯一标识每个文件,而filename列用于存储文件名。

    1. 插入文件信息
      接下来,我们可以使用INSERT语句将文件信息插入到数据库表中。在插入文件信息时,我们需要指定文件名并将其存储到filename列中。例如,我们可以使用以下SQL语句将一个名为"example.jpg"的文件插入到files表中:
    INSERT INTO files (filename) VALUES ('example.jpg');
    

    上述语句将在files表中插入一行数据,其中filename列的值为"example.jpg"。

    1. 查询文件信息
      一旦我们将文件信息插入到数据库表中,我们可以使用SELECT语句查询特定的文件信息。例如,我们可以使用以下SQL语句查询filename为"example.jpg"的文件:
    SELECT * FROM files WHERE filename = 'example.jpg';
    

    上述语句将返回filename为"example.jpg"的文件的所有信息。

    1. 更新文件信息
      如果需要更新文件的名称,我们可以使用UPDATE语句来更新filename列的值。例如,我们可以使用以下SQL语句将filename为"example.jpg"的文件名更新为"new_example.jpg":
    UPDATE files SET filename = 'new_example.jpg' WHERE filename = 'example.jpg';
    

    上述语句将更新filename为"example.jpg"的文件的文件名为"new_example.jpg"。

    1. 删除文件信息
      如果需要删除特定的文件信息,我们可以使用DELETE语句来删除该行数据。例如,我们可以使用以下SQL语句删除filename为"example.jpg"的文件:
    DELETE FROM files WHERE filename = 'example.jpg';
    

    上述语句将删除filename为"example.jpg"的文件的所有信息。

    总结:在数据库中,filename是一个用来存储文件名的字段。通过创建包含filename列的数据库表,我们可以插入、查询、更新和删除文件信息。这样可以更好地管理和组织文件。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部